Output d3ac5e23983938567a8c8c83d70fcc3c4abe5cd8a14c077668e6378b1787e607:1

value
1659894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5ea41f754ae4b23036a8d1db6454a58047c4b3 OP_EQUALVERIFY OP_CHECKSIG
address
1MBViB5bcQiP5FhuMhUgSSGwppf8fnH7xF
transaction
d3ac5e23983938567a8c8c83d70fcc3c4abe5cd8a14c077668e6378b1787e607
confirmations
480818
spent
true